Swami Taponidhi

Swami Taponidhi Saraswati was initiated into Poorna Sannyasa by his Guru Swami Niranjanananda Saraswati, the Spiritual Head and Paramacharya of Bihar School of Yoga, in January 2004. A marine engineer by profession from 1979 to 1995,it was during the expansion of his own company that he completed a certificate Course in Yogic studies in 1999 and at the turn of the century he completed the Yoga Teachers Training Course from Ghantali Mitra Mandal, Mumbai in May 2000. Immediately on completion he started teaching Yoga for Peace, Plenty and Prosperity in Mumbai. He simultaneously joined “Diploma Course in Yoga Philosophy” at Mumbai University and stood first among the participants in May 2001. The journey of Yoga had begun. Swami Taponidhi, being fully involved in Yoga as a way of life resigned from the directorship of the packaging company floated by him and went ahead to pursue higher studies by joining the Masters Course in Applied Yogic Science at Bihar Yoga Bharati, the deemed to be university started by Swami Niranjan.
